Mumbai to Amritsar 4-Day Itinerary - October 15, 2023

Sunday, October 15: Exploring Mumbai

In the morning, kickstart your Mumbai adventure with a visit to the iconic Gateway of India. Marvel at this monumental arch overlooking the Arabian Sea and take a boat ride to explore Elephanta Caves. Afternoon can be spent wandering through the vibrant chaos of Colaba Causeway, a bustling street market where you can shop for souvenirs and sample delicious street food. In the evening, head to Marine Drive, also known as the "Queen's Necklace," and enjoy a leisurely walk along the promenade while witnessing a beautiful sunset.

  • Gateway of India: Budget ₹50, Time Spent: 1-2 hours
  • Elephanta Caves: Budget ₹500 (including boat ride), Time Spent: 3-4 hours
  • Colaba Causeway: Budget varies, Time Spent: 2-3 hours
  • Marine Drive: Free, Time Spent: 1-2 hours
Monday, October 16: Agra - The City of Taj

Depart from Mumbai and take a flight to Agra. Morning is allotted for exploring the magnificent Taj Mahal, a UNESCO World Heritage Site and one of the Seven Wonders of the World. Spend the afternoon by visiting the Agra Fort, a red sandstone fortress that offers panoramic views of the Taj Mahal. As the day comes to an end, take a stroll through the bustling streets of Sadar Bazaar, a local market where you can shop for handicrafts and indulge in delicious street food.

  • Taj Mahal: Budget ₹1300 (foreign tourists), Time Spent: 2-3 hours
  • Agra Fort: Budget ₹650 (foreign tourists), Time Spent: 2-3 hours
  • Sadar Bazaar: Budget varies, Time Spent: 2-3 hours
Tuesday, October 17: Golden Temple, Amritsar

Fly from Agra to Amritsar, the spiritual and cultural hub of Punjab. Start your day by visiting the grand Golden Temple, also known as Harmandir Sahib. Witness the serene beauty of the temple and experience the communal meal offered at the langar. In the afternoon, explore Jallianwala Bagh, a historic garden commemorating the tragic massacre of 1919. Conclude the day with the awe-inspiring Wagah Border ceremony, a ceremonial parade that takes place at the India-Pakistan border every evening.

  • Golden Temple: Free, Time Spent: 2-3 hours
  • Jallianwala Bagh: Budget ₹10, Time Spent: 1-2 hours
  • Wagah Border Ceremony: Budget ₹20, Time Spent: 2-3 hours
Wednesday, October 18: Amritsar Exploration

On your last day in Amritsar, visit the historic Durgiana Temple, known for its resemblance to the Golden Temple. Then, head to the Partition Museum, which provides insightful exhibits about the partition of India and Pakistan. In the afternoon, explore the vibrant streets of Hall Bazaar, where you can shop for traditional Punjabi attire and taste local delicacies. Wrap up your Amritsar journey with a visit to Gobindgarh Fort, a historic fortress offering cultural shows and interactive exhibits.

  • Durgiana Temple: Budget ₹30, Time Spent: 1-2 hours
  • Partition Museum: Budget ₹10, Time Spent: 2-3 hours
  • Hall Bazaar: Budget varies, Time Spent: 2-3 hours
  • Gobindgarh Fort: Budget ₹250, Time Spent: 2-3 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

While in Amritsar, consider exploring the peaceful Ram Tirath Temple, associated with the ancient epic, Ramayana. Nature enthusiasts and bird lovers can visit Harike Wetland, a beautiful bird sanctuary situated near Amritsar. For a delicious culinary experience, don't miss the vegetarian delights at Kesar Da Dhaba or the lip-smacking street food at Lawrence Road. These off the beaten path attractions and local favorites offer a deeper insight into the heritage and culture of the region.
